Be aware though that the 0.8 runtime doesn't support any modern VR game (although maybe SteamVR might work a bit with it, I haven't tried).
There are only ever 2 versions of the recent software available, the latest stable (currently v19) and latest beta (v20PTC). You can't roll back or install other versions between 1.3 (first of the new software in 2016) and v18.
Last I tried (january) the DK2 was kind of working, but the camera tracking was broken so you couldn't move your head (just rotate it). I haven't tried since then to see if it is now completely unusable like the DK1.
